Google Chrome, a browser built on the Blink layout engine that aims to be minimalistic and versatile at the same time, is now at version 32.0.1700.39 Beta.

A new Beta version of Google Chrome has been made available, featuring a large number of changes and fixes.

According to the announcement, the files app is no longer popping up after opening the lid with a sd/usb device in, a small bug in bookmarks_bridge.cc has been fixed, port forwarding over raw USB has been fixed, canceling device enumeration requests is now working properly, and the "Apps" bookmark is now shown when the App Launcher is enabled.
